Rob Zerjav – President

2025 marks Rob’s 29th season in Minor League Baseball, all with the Wisconsin Timber Rattlers. A native of Green Bay, Wisconsin, Rob received his bachelor’s degree in Marketing from the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ater. He began his career with the Timber Rattlers as an unpaid intern before joining the full-time staff as a group sales representative. After two years in group ticket sales, Rob was promoted to Director of Baseball Operations and then to Vice President of Baseball Operations. Following the 2002 season, he was promoted to Team President and General Manager. In 2004, Rob was recognized as UW-Whitewater’s Outstanding Recent Alumni and has been recognized as the Midwest League Executive of the Year three times – in 2007, 2012, and 2018.

Rob was instrumental in bringing a Northwoods League baseball team to Fond du Lac, Wisconsin, and has served as the Fond du Lac Dock Spiders Team President since their inception in 2017. The team has seen much success in their short existence and was named Entrepreneur of the Year at the Marian University Business and Industry Awards in 2017. The team captured their first league title the next season in only their second year of existence and repeated as league champion in 2020.

Rob resides in De Pere, Wisconsin, with his wife, Nikki, and their sons Cooper and Davis.

Jim Misudek – General Manager

2025 marks Jim’s 19th season in baseball after completing his first season with the Dock Spiders in 2022. Prior to his return to Fond du Lac, Jim spent 14 years with Major League organizations. Most recently, he spent six seasons as the Senior Manager, Baseball Communications with the Baltimore Orioles. Jim’s primary responsibilities included the creation of daily press notes, drafting press releases, producing the club’s annual media guide, arranging interviews for players and staff, coordinating press conferences and press box operations, while serving as a primary media contact for the club in Baltimore, throughout Spring Training, and on team road trips during the season. Prior to joining the Orioles front office, he spent five seasons with the Atlanta Braves as Media Relations Coordinator, one year as an intern with the Cincinnati Reds media relations department, and two seasons with the Milwaukee Brewers. In 2007, Jim served an intern in the Brewers media relations department and 2008 was spent as a sales representative while assisting with media relations duties. He also assisted Major League Baseball and the Brewers media relations department with their 2008 Postseason appearance.

On behalf of Major League Baseball, Jim was selected and invited to provide media relations support for the Major League Baseball All-Star Game in 2015, 2016, 2017, and 2019, the 2013 World Baseball Classic, the National League Championship Series in 2012, 2013, and 2014, the American League Championship Series in 2015 and 2018, and the American League Division Series in 2019.

As a native of Fond du Lac, Wisconsin, graduate of University of Wisconsin-Fond du Lac (Class of 2004), and graduate of the University of Wisconsin-La Crosse, Jim began his baseball career as an intern with the Wisconsin Timber Rattlers in 2006. Jim is a member of Fond du Lac Noon Rotary, serves on the Board of Directors for Destination Lake Winnebago Region, is an ambassador for Envision Greater Fond du Lac, serves on the Advisory Park Board for the City of Fond du Lac, and was named a 2023 Future 5 recipient by Envision Greater Fond du Lac. He resides in Fond du Lac with his wife, Jessica.

Nikki, a native of Hortonville, Wisconsin, brings wide-ranging industry experience from her 10-year career with the Wisconsin Timber Rattlers from 1999 to 2009. She began as Retail Manager and rose through the ranks to become Vice President of Communications. During her tenure, she was part of the leadership team that guided the team through its transition to becoming a Milwaukee Brewers affiliate. In 2004, she was named the Midwest League Female Executive of the Year and earned the Seattle Mariners’ “John Ellis Award” for outstanding community service three years in a row (2005, 2006, 2007). Widely known in the community as “Promo Nikki,” she served as the in-game host for Timber Rattlers games and was voted the “Fans Choice Bobblehead” in 2006. Since her departure from the Timber Rattlers, Nikki has focused on raising her family while actively engaging in various nonprofit initiatives. She has also served as a fill-in morning show co-host on multiple radio stations throughout Northeastern Wisconsin.
